Output 3ffca3eb963b429bd9b034df9ad45240a348fa63afef0a22c4202d26af6d6bb1:23

value
1449083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4140fca682da126b71ece3fbd317973466ba53c1 OP_EQUAL
address
37e3hP9z66Cn3z5uae6Tcfbph6vD3qqxZN
transaction
3ffca3eb963b429bd9b034df9ad45240a348fa63afef0a22c4202d26af6d6bb1
confirmations
168406
spent
true